Women's Tennis Extends Streak to Four with Win over Maryville, Men Fall to Saints

 ST. LOUIS, MO. - The University of Missouri-St. Louis women's tennis team picked up their fourth straight win on Tuesday against Maryville University, 4-3. The UMSL men's tennis team fell 6-1 in their match against Maryville. Great Lakes Valley Conference Player of the Week, Odette Beagrie, extended her doubles and singles winning streaks to four straight matches each.

Women
Odette Beagrie and Leticia Lunge secured the top doubles match, 6-2, for the Tritons (5-4). Victoria Lisson and Georgina Cupper won the second doubles match, 6-4, for the Saints (6-4) over Anna Domingo and Tara Erler. Clara Lopez Bueno and Maja Lietzau won the doubles point for the Tritons with a 6-4 win in the final doubles match.

Odette Beagrie won the No. 1 singles match 6-4, 6-1 over Emily Orlove to continue her win streak.

Maja Lietzau was forced to withdraw during the first set of No. 2 singles which awarded the Saints a point.

Carolina Velazquez fell to Anna Domingo in the first set of No. 3 singles, 6-4, before rattling off two straight set wins, 6-2, 6-1, to win a second point for the Saints.

Nicole Pafundi also won a point for the Saints with a win in No. 6 singles over Clara Lopez Bueno.

Tara Erler won the first set of No. 5 singles, 6-3, before claiming the match with a 7-6 tiebreaker in the second set to tie the match at 3-3 for the Tritons.

Leticia Lunge won the first set o No. 4 singles 7-5, but Victoria Lisson claimed the second set 6-4 to tie the match. Lunge answered with a 6-3 third set win to complete the 4-3 win for the Tritons.

Men
Marcos Navas and Karl Heinrichs won the top doubles match 6-3 to start the match for the Tritons (1-7). Jack Beuttell-Triggs and Yann Frezouls won the second doubles match for Maryville (5-4), 6-4, over Jose Mayorga and Raphael Kerndl. Erik Aarthun and Juan Suero defeated Juan Vigil and AJ Bower to give the Saints the doubles point.

Jose Mayorga won the No. 3 singles match for the Tritons with a pair of 6-4, 6-4 sets over Jose Hernandez.

Mario Aleksic topped Marcos Navas in a three set match for the top singles point. Navas won set one 6-3, but fell to Aleksic in the final two sets, 6-4, 6-2.

Beuttell-Triggs defeated Juan Vigil in No. 2 singles.

Raphael Kerndl fell to Sebastian Trigosso in three sets at No. 4 singles.

Yann Frezouls topped Karl Heinrichs in No. 5 singles in three sets as well.

AJ Bower fell to Juan Suero in the No. 6 singles match.
